WebMar 29, 2024 · Python string.strip () function basically removes all the leading as well as trailing spaces from a particular string. Thus, we can use this method to completely trim a string in Python. Syntax: string.strip (character) character: It is an optional parameter.

WebIn Python, there are two common methods for removing characters from strings: To replace strings, use the replace () string method.
